Fresh Tank size on Baja

Does anyone know the true FW gallon size of the Baja version on a 185RB? I'm getting differing answers from salesman, PDI kid & website for some strange reason.

I have the 195RB Baja which should have the same size FW tank which is 35 gallons. I've run a full FW tank into the black/grey tanks to clean everything out. I was able to completely fill both the black/grey tanks once (24 gallons combined) then the grey tank again to 3/4 full (approximately 11 gallons) before the pump started hitting some air.

It's not apparent on Jayco's web site what the differences are. You have to select the Configure & Price link then hover over the "?" at the end of the configuration line item for the Baja option. That will pop up a box that shows the features included with the Baja option including FW tank size.

Yes - I do think they could make some improvements. I don't think there are any pictures on the official web site showing the physical differences between the standard and Baja edition. My dealer gave me a copy of a technical specs sheet that had all the dimensions, weights, and capacities for the model we wanted. It showed these for both the standard and the Baja editions.
